An exceptional home of stature providing generous accommodation including an entrance porch, hallway, lounge, study, dining room, dining kitchen, garden room, utility, WC. The first floor includes four bedrooms, en-suite and dressing room to the master and a family bathroom. Occupying a corner plot, the landscaped gardens are generally low in maintenance and easy on the eye with 'Al Fresco' dining at the centre.

Accommodation
Built by the award winning 'Jones Homes', this executive detached home occupies a commanding corner position with beautifully presented accommodation including an entrance porch with a pillared canopy, entrance hallway with engineered flooring, striking lounge with a stone and exposed brick feature fireplace and decorative bay window, dining room with a feature brick wall and 'French' doors, study, dining kitchen complete with centre island and integrated appliances, garden room, utiality room and WC.

The first features a generous landing, master suite again with a feature bay, dressing room and upgraded en-suite bathroom, three further bedrooms all with fitted furniture and a main contemporary shower room. Externally, there are landscaped gardens, driveway parking and a garage.
